Job Summary

The Biomedical Equipment Technician III (BMET III) is an advanced-level technical role responsible for maintaining, repairing, and calibrating a wide range of biomedical and life-support equipment. This position requires strong technical expertise, problem-solving abilities, and the ability to operate independently while mentoring junior technicians. A BMET III plays a key role in supporting patient care by ensuring all clinical equipment operates safely, efficiently, and in compliance with standards.

Responsibilities

  • Use and maintain electronic test equipment, power supplies, pressure/vacuum gauges, and biomedical devices

  • Assemble, repair, and maintain electronic devices per specifications

  • Service and repair life-support and high-risk patient care and diagnostic equipment

  • Support scheduled maintenance programs, assign work orders, and ensure accurate documentation

  • Document all activities within the computerized maintenance system and provide regular updates

  • Diagnose and repair equipment malfunctions in accordance with technical specifications

  • Research, order, and track required parts for repairs and maintenance

  • Provide technical training and in-service support to facility staff on equipment use

  • Demonstrate cost awareness and responsible use of resources

  • Maintain professional relationships with colleagues, clinical staff, and vendors

  • Mentor Biomedical Technicians and apprentices

  • Meet department performance standards consistently

  • Maintain a clean, organized, and safe workspace

  • Adhere to facility policies and procedures

  • Supervise or coordinate OEM or vendor technicians during on-site service

  • Collaborate with leadership to support professional growth and skill advancement
